Antoine Pitrou authored
sporadic crashes in multi-thread programs when several long deallocator chains ran concurrently and involved subclasses of built-in container types. Because of this change, a couple extension modules compiled for 3.2.4 (those which use the trashcan mechanism, despite it being undocumented) will not be loadable by 3.2.3 and earlier. However, extension modules compiled for 3.2.3 and earlier will be loadable by 3.2.4.

Victor Stinner authored
Fix window.addch() of the curses module for special characters like curses.ACS_HLINE: the Python function addch(int) and addch(bytes) is now calling the C function waddch()/mvwaddch() (as it was done in Python 3.2), instead of wadd_wch()/mvwadd_wch(). The Python function addch(str) is still calling the C function wadd_wch()/mvwadd_wch() if the Python curses is linked to libncursesw.
